Understanding Data Masking

Data masking, sometimes referred to as data obfuscation, is
the process of concealing sensitive data by replacing it with fictitious but
realistic data. This allows organizations to use datasets for testing,
training, analytics, and software development without exposing actual
confidential information. Unlike encryption or anonymization, data masking
maintains the format and usability of the data, making it ideal for
non-production environments where realistic data is essential.

Data masking helps protect personally identifiable
information (PII), payment card information (PCI), and protected health
information (PHI) from unauthorized access while enabling innovation and
operational efficiency.

Dynamic Data Masking (DDM) on the Rise

Unlike traditional static data masking (SDM), which protects
data in storage, dynamic data masking safeguards data in real time as it is
accessed. This approach is increasingly popular among organizations that
require flexible access control without duplicating datasets. DDM ensures that
only authorized users can view or interact with sensitive data during live
operations.

Data Masking in DevOps and Continuous Testing

As DevOps and Agile development methodologies become
mainstream, masked data is being integrated into continuous testing pipelines.
This ensures that developers and testers can work with production-like data
without compromising security. The trend aligns with the growing need for
secure and compliant software development life cycles (SDLC).

Focus on Data Privacy and Regulatory Compliance

The enforcement of global data protection laws—such as GDPR
(Europe), CCPA (California), and HIPAA (US healthcare)—has increased demand for
data masking solutions. Organizations are using masking to achieve data
minimization, privacy by design, and compliance readiness without disrupting
business processes.
